Output 4fba02a08b44824b4c24355546a35872af65b64dea66b913529e6b3276616de0:3

value
46943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 016f98f85f3766bc67159767b4fc755b24577cdc OP_EQUAL
address
31pcHfjPP5kKX7ch4nmHifUPz6N5ntFhAR
transaction
4fba02a08b44824b4c24355546a35872af65b64dea66b913529e6b3276616de0
confirmations
28552
spent
true